What is Green Build Technology Net Cash per Share?

Net Cash per Share is calculated as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ities minus Total Liabilities minus Minority Interest and then divided by Shares Outstanding (EOP). Green Build Technology's Net Cash per Share for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2024 was S$-0.01.

Green Build Technology Net Cash per Share Calculation

In the calculation of a company's Net Cash per Share, assets other than cash and short term investments are considered to be worth nothing. But the company has to pay its debt and other liabilities in full. This is an extremely conservative way of valuation. Most companies have negative Net Cash per Share. But sometimes a company's price may be lower than its net-cash.

Green Build Technology's Net Cash per Share for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2024 is calculated as

Net Cash per Share (A: Dec. 2024 )
=(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ities-Total Liabilities-Minority Interest)/Shares Outstanding (EOP)
=(0.184-4.376-0.188)/292.259
=-0.01

Green Build Technology  (SGX:Y06) Net Cash per Share Explanation

Ben Graham invested in situations where the company's stock price was lower than its net-cash. He assigned some value to the company's other current asset. The value is called Net Current Asset Value (NCAV). One research study, covering the years 1970 through 1983 showed that portfolios picked at the beginning of each year, and held for one year, returned 29.4 percent, on average, over the 13-year period, compared to 11.5 percent for the S&P 500 Index. Other studies of Graham's strategy produced similar results.

Green Build Technology Ltd is an investment holding company. The company operates in four segments: Insulation, which constructs and operates external insulation projects; Underground Utility Tunnel, which constructs and operates underground utility tunnels for utility lines such as electricity, gas supply pipes, and water supply pipes and communications lines such as fiber optics, television, and telephone cables; Project Management segment provides consultation services; Materials Trading segment is into trading of green technology materials, and Others segment is into investment holding. The company derives its revenue from the PRC.
